I have mixed feelings. It was slow to start, but at no point did I consider giving up. I wanted to know what happened. However, there were two main things that bothered me. The narrator voice rang false - Richard Swan must have a low opinion of woman. I also hated the insta-love plot- there was no reason for her to love Matas, so her love of him and his death felt like a plot device. The second part that bothered me was a poor marriage of political intrigue and detective story. I find it hard to believe that in the face of armies being stood up and the potential fall of an empire, a political actor would say “no, I really need to solve this insignificant woman’s murder first, who mostly merits the name of ‘Bauer’s wife’”. The character development across the board struck me as false; and I don’t think I will read the rest of the series.
